It turns out there are two different Crosshairs releases for the Transformers: The Last Knight toyline. One has an issue with a wheel popping off easily and his guns not being able to peg into his cape properly. You can go to the 5 minute mark of the review below to see an example of such issues. He was rereleased soon after with these issues fixed. The problem is that both are being put on shelves at the same time in the same markets but the good news is that they are each coded differently so that you know which one you are getting.

According to Yonoid from Cybertron.ca, the embossed number on the back of the box for the fixed version is 72011. The one with the issues has the number 72081 instead.

So I got these two guys and I am unimpressed

Image

Bee has a very cool transformation that somehow remains fresh even though its another take on the same transformation we have had for a decade (arms and legs end up in the same place as always). Its basically another take on the MPM transformation at a smaller scale and thats pretty cool. But man does he feel flimsy ad cheap. Maybe its because most pieces are thinner than what we get in the generations line due to the robot parts not being integrated into the vehicle. And both end up feeling overstuffed in vehicle mode. It feels lke the vehicles are about to burst. And there is some clear plastic parts on Bee that require quite a bit of pressure applied. Kinda scary.

Crosshair's deco is really lackluster in robot mode. Its just green, green everywhere. But at least in car mode, its the complete opposite where there is paint all over the place. I think its fully painted. Plus nice to see the rims are wheel painted.

Ok toys but by no means mind blowing.
